Product Description: This chemical is widely used as a chelating agent in various industrial and laboratory applications. It effectively binds to metal ions, making it valuable in water treatment processes to prevent scale formation and control metal contamination. In the textile industry, it is employed to improve the quality of dyeing processes by stabilizing metal ions that could otherwise interfere with the dyes. Additionally, it finds use in cleaning formulations, where it helps to remove metal deposits and enhance the efficiency of detergents. In analytical chemistry, it serves as a reagent for complexometric titrations to determine the concentration of metal ions in solutions. Its ability to sequester metals also makes it useful in agriculture, where it is applied in fertilizers to improve nutrient availability to plants.
